Terraform是一种开源的基础设施即代码工具,它允许开发人员使用简单的声明语言定义和配置云基础设施。在运行Terraform之前,您需要选择一个运行环境来执行Terraform命令。
以下是几个常见的运行Terraform的环境选项:
- 本地机器:您可以在自己的计算机上安装Terraform,并在命令行界面中运行Terraform命令。这是最简单和最常见的运行Terraform的方式。您可以从Terraform官方网站(https://www.terraform.io/downloads.html)下载适用于您操作系统的Terraform二进制文件。
- CI/CD工具:如果您正在使用持续集成/持续交付(CI/CD)工具来自动化基础设施的部署,您可以在该工具的构建或部署流程中运行Terraform命令。流行的CI/CD工具包括Jenkins、GitLab CI、CircleCI等。您可以在相应的文档中找到如何配置和运行Terraform的详细信息。
- 云提供商的托管服务:大多数主流云提供商都提供了托管Terraform的服务。例如,腾讯云提供了Terraform云开发工具(https://cloud.tencent.com/product/tfcloud),您可以在该服务中运行和管理Terraform配置。通过使用这些托管服务,您可以轻松地在云端运行和管理Terraform,而无需担心本地环境的配置和维护。
总结起来,您可以在本地机器、CI/CD工具或云提供商的托管服务中运行Terraform。选择哪种方式取决于您的具体需求和偏好。